Action item from the Mirewater tide-table widget incident. Owner: release manager. Widget cached stale harbor offsets after the DST change, showing tides six hours off for two days. Required: add a cache-invalidation check to the release checklist, block deploys when offset tables are older than 24 hours, and verify the Saltgate harbor feed before each cut. Deadline: next release. Checklist template and sign-off procedure are documented on the internal page below.

wiki page, kawif-bajep: https://artifactory.zarqelforge.internal/issue/browse/display/display/projects/spaces/secrets/000fe6ec5a46af29355003e1

Mobile deep-link routing for the Wrenfield app is owned by the Pathstitch team. They maintain the routing manifest that maps marketing links to in-app screens, and they must sign off before any release that changes URL schemes or universal-link entitlements. Release managers should request manifest review at least two days before code freeze; late changes risk broken campaign links in production. For routing sign-off, manifest updates, or questions about deprecated link patterns, contact the Pathstitch team directly.

escalation mailbox, bafog-fafog: ulador@paliqlabs.internal

## Deployment

The Coinflip assignment service deploys as a single stateless container behind the Marrowgate proxy. Assignments are deterministic per subject hash, so replicas need no coordination. Roll out with a canary at five percent, then promote once error rates hold steady for ten minutes. The service reads its configuration at startup, shown below.

settings of tagef-bawif:
DRUIX_HOST=druix.zemvarlabs.internal
DRUIX_PORT=8000